Help us understand the problem. What is going on with this article?

CData API Server で5分でMySQL からREST API を生成

More than 3 years have passed since last update.

CData API Server がどれだけ超高速でRDB からREST API を作れるか?

ケースとして、すでに公開したいデータがMySQL に一つのテーブルとして格納されているとします。

CData API Server をダウンロード:所要時間2分##

CData のAPI Server ページから製品のインストールを行います。

MySQL とAPI Server を接続:所要時間1分

「設定」タブの「接続」からデータベースへの接続を行います。
apiserver3.png

API として公開するテーブルおよびカラムを選択:所要時間1分

「設定」タブの「リソース」からクリックして公開するテーブルおよびカラムを選択して、保存します。
apiserver5.png

API にアクセスできるユーザーを設定しAuthトークンを発行:所要時間1分

「設定」タブの「ユーザー」からどのユーザーにデータへのアクセスを与えるかや、権限、リクエスト制限などを設定します。保存するとAuth トークンが発行されます。

以上で設定は完了で、選択したDB テーブルのデータがREST API として公開され、ドキュメントも自動生成されています。管理コンソールでは、公開されたAPI のモニタリングが可能です。
apiserver6.png

jonathanh
データドライバーのCData Software Inc. の日本代表。
Why not register and get more from Qiita?
  1. We will deliver articles that match you
    By following users and tags, you can catch up information on technical fields that you are interested in as a whole
  2. you can read useful information later efficiently
    By "stocking" the articles you like, you can search right away
Comments
No comments
Sign up for free and join this conversation.
If you already have a Qiita account
Why do not you register as a user and use Qiita more conveniently?
You need to log in to use this function. Qiita can be used more conveniently after logging in.
You seem to be reading articles frequently this month. Qiita can be used more conveniently after logging in.
  1. We will deliver articles that match you
    By following users and tags, you can catch up information on technical fields that you are interested in as a whole
  2. you can read useful information later efficiently
    By "stocking" the articles you like, you can search right away
ユーザーは見つかりませんでした